Significant flow velocity reduction at the intracranial aneurysm neck after endovascular treatment leads to favourable angiographic outcome: a prospective study
Background With widely usage of flow diverter in intracranial aneurysm treatment, some previously used predictors may not be effective in evaluating the recurrence risk. We aimed to comprehensively re-evaluate the predictors of intracranial aneurysm outcome with various endovascular treatment method...
